Iran to introduce sanctions against EU, UK soon

Iran will soon impose retaliatory sanctions against the EU and the UK, spokesman of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Iran Nasser Kanaani said, reported from the Iranian media.

"The actions of the EU and the UK are a sign of their mental inability to properly understand the realities of modern Iran, as well as their confusion about the power in our country. Iran will soon announce a list of new sanctions against human rights violators and promoters of terrorism in the EU and the UK,” Kanaani said.

On January 23, the EU published a new package of personal sanctions against Iran, including 18 individuals and 19 organizations that the EU considers involved in the suppression of protests in the country. The list also includes the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) and its regional divisions.

On January 18, the European Parliament approved a resolution calling on the EU leadership to include the IRGC in the list of terrorist organizations.
